Cost of upvc window repair upvc window

The type of windows you choose and the work required will determine the price of repairs to upvc windows near me. The majority of repairs to double-pane window are more expensive than a single-pane window.

For instance, you may need to replace the hinges and seals inside your window. Broken window springs could cause the sash to become stuck when you open the window. A broken lock or handle could also make your window vulnerable to burglars.

There are many reasons why your windows need to be repaired. Broken glass, hinges that aren't aligned correctly or loose hinges are only a few of the reasons your windows should be repaired. Faulty seals or a faulty balance or spring are another possible causes.

If you're looking for a cost-effective way to fix your window, a DIY repair for your window using repairing upvc windows can be the answer. Before you begin you must know how much you'll have to spend on the repairs.

For most homeowners, it's more affordable to replace a single-pane glass window than it is to replace a whole window. You can save hundreds of dollars by fixing your window rather than replacing it.

However the cost of replacing a damaged frame could be quite expensive. They can be costly due to the rot that may develop when the wood is exposed to humidity. When replacing the frame, you will have to remove all of the damaged sections and replace them with new wood.

Depending on the size of your window, you could pay between $150 and $300 to get your windows repaired. It is crucial to keep in mind that you'll need two people to fix your windows. If you have more than one window you can save money.

You will need to buy the screen if you want to replace your window screens. Screens are priced differently, depending on their thickness and mesh material. Screen replacements can be as low as $150 to $350.
